Abstract
This paper proposes a method for using dynamic programming to solve the optimal chiller sequencing problem and to eliminate the deficiencies of conventional methods. The coefficient of performance of the chiller is adopted as the objective function because it is concave. The Lagrangian method determines the optimal chiller loading in each feasible state. The potential performance of the proposed method is examined with reference to three example systems. The proposed method consumes much less power than the conventional method, and is very appropriate for application in air-conditioning systems.
